Using the DTM above, what occurs to a population during Stage 2?

Geography
1 answer:
Lelu [443]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

During stage 2, the death rate drops while birth rates remain the same.

Explanation:

The first option is not correct because this is a characteristic of the later stages in the DTM.

The second option is correct because, during stage 2, the death rate drops because of improved living conditions and healthcare, while the birth rates remain the same, leading to population explosion.

Which of the following is an example of an outdated theory based on the consensus of the scientific community ? A. Big Bang
Natasha_Volkova [10]

Answer:

B. Geocentric solar system

Explanation:

The scientific community is the one that accepts or dismisses theories. Some theories are accepted, and that is because there are enough evidence that support them, while some theories are dismissed as they have been proven over time that they are not correct.

One of the theories that is outdated and has been dismissed by the scientific community is the theory of the geocentric solar system. This theory has been in place and widely accepted for a very long time, pretty much two millenniums.

This theory was basically suggesting that the Earth is the center of the solar system. The Sun, Moon, all the other planets that were known, as well as the stars, were all orbiting around the Earth. This has been proven as wrong (except that the Moon is orbiting around Earth), and that the theory is far away from the truth, so naturally once there were enough evidence it was dismissed.
